Well, as of 1 p.m. yesterday, the contractor I work for at Grand Gulf Nuclear Station was asked to leave the site. Due to heightened security levels at all U.S. nuclear plants, all sites have done the same. As of today we are still off and will possibly return to work tommorrow. Could have gone teal hunting, but just thought it wouldn't be right to enjoy a day like today while so many Americans are suffering. I have friends and family that are at alert recall status to their respective branches of the military. I truly hope they are not recalled, but I do want to see Justice, not hatred, prevail. I know the bases have been covered, but there is no such thing as too much prayer or caring thoughts for those directly involved. Also, please all be aware that Blood drives are taking place nationwide to send to the affected areas of attack. Hopefully, in a few days, America will join together to rebuild and become stronger in spite of these acts of terror..
